Acetaminophen (Tylenol) blunts empathy
Acetaminophen – a potent physical painkiller that also reduces empathy for other people’s suffering – blunts physical and social pain by reducing activation in brain areas (i.e. anterior insula and anterior cingulate) thought to be related to emotional awareness and motivation
 Quoting: [link to www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ov (secure)]


Tylenol, a pain reliever little known to the general public before 1975, is now the largest-selling brand among all health and beauty products in the world, and an important money-maker for its parent company, Johnson & Johnson, the world's largest manufacturer of health-care items.

From your link, it specifically targets 'positive empathy'. To me, this sounds like it causes 'depression'.

"Experiencing and expressing positive empathy for other people’s good fortunes have striking personal and interpersonal benefits (Morelli et al., 2015). A substantial amount of research shows that understanding and sharing in other people’s pleasurable experiences foster psychological health, interpersonal trust, intimacy, and a prosocial orientation, both for the source and the recipient of positive empathy (Smith et al., 1989; Gable et al., 2006; Sallquist et al., 2009; Reis et al., 2010; Morelli et al., 2015; Andreychik and Lewis, 2017). Despite this host of findings on the psychological and relational benefits of positive empathy, however, our understanding of the physiological bases of positive empathy remains limited."
